WIFI at my hotel is good. If you have AT&T the moment you land you will get a text about international day pass which is $10 per day. The coverage is still spotty and I don't know if I am getting all my calls. Sometimes calls come in from a Mexican area code which are calls that are getting re-routed to me. The only problem is I can't get retrieve my voicemails. The call always fails. Texting works well.To answer your question it is AT&T Mexico but I don't know about their towers.
